Telecommunications Engineering Specialists

Design or configure wired, wireless, and satellite communications systems for voice, video, and data services. Supervise installation, service, and maintenance.

Computer and Information Research Scientists

Conduct research into fundamental computer and information science as theorists, designers, or inventors. Develop solutions to problems in the field of computer hardware and software.
